Overview
A balloon is a type of aircraft that remains aloft through buoyancy rather than aerodynamic lift or powered propulsion. It rises because the air inside its large fabric bag is lighter than the surrounding atmosphere, so the aircraft floats. Balloons are most often flown for recreation, sightseeing and sport, but they have also been used for scientific observation, meteorology and historical military reconnaissance.

Typical balloons share a few fundamental elements. The envelope is the large fabric bag that contains hot air or a lighter-than-air gas. The gondola or basket hangs beneath the envelope and carries people and equipment. Hot-air balloons include a burner to heat the air inside the envelope; gas balloons rely on helium or, historically, hydrogen. Ballast (usually sandbags) and vents or valves allow pilots to control altitude by releasing weight or gas, or by heating and cooling the lifting medium.
Types and notable variants
- Hot-air balloons: use burners to heat internal air; the most common form for leisure and sport.
- Gas balloons: use a low-density gas such as helium for continuous lift without a burner.
- Hybrid or Rozière balloons: combine a separate hot-air section and a gas cell to improve long-distance performance.
- Tethered balloons: anchored to the ground and used for short rides, advertising, or observation.
History and development
The first practical manned balloon flights were achieved in the late 18th century, opening a new era in human flight. Early experiments and public demonstrations rapidly showed balloons could carry people and instruments aloft, and they were used for scientific measurement and for military observation before powered flight became widespread. Over time materials, burners and safety practices improved, and modern balloons are used mainly for sport and tourism.
Operation, uses and distinctions
Pilots control a balloon largely by changing altitude: climbing or descending allows it to enter air layers moving in different directions, so cross-country travel depends on wind currents. Unlike an airship, which has engines and steering surfaces, a balloon has no propulsion and cannot directly steer; it drifts with the wind. This difference is often highlighted in comparisons between balloons and airships. Safety, regulation and modern significance
Balloon operations are regulated in most countries: pilots normally require certification, and flights follow rules for airspace and weather. Popular uses today include tourism rides over scenic areas, competitive ballooning events, scientific platforms for atmospheric sampling, and tethered promotional displays. Because balloons are quiet and provide a slow-moving platform, they remain valued for leisurely observation and experiential aviation despite their lack of directional control; pilots therefore plan flights carefully and rely on experience and meteorological information from sources such as wind charts and forecasts.
Questions and answers
Q: What is a balloon aircraft?
A: A balloon aircraft is a kind of aircraft that stays in the sky by floating.
Q: Why do people fly in balloons?
A: People fly in balloons mostly for fun.
Q: How is a balloon different from an airship?
A: An airship is a floating aircraft that has an engine and can change its direction of movement, while a balloon has no engine and has no way to change its direction of movement.
Q: How does a balloon travel?
A: A balloon travels by moving with the wind.
Q: What is the bottom of a balloon called?
A: The bottom of a balloon is called the "basket" where people can sit or stand.
Q: What is the top of a balloon called?
A: The top of a balloon is a big cloth bag called the "envelope".
Q: What is the function of the envelope of a balloon?
A: The envelope of a balloon acts as the top of the balloon and holds the gas that keeps the balloon afloat in the air.
